Ohio State Student Named Intern
at Leading A.I. Organization




PLAIN CITY, Ohio, July 6, 2004 — Dan Wells, Chillicothe, Ohio, has been selected as the summer beef-marketing intern for Select Sires Inc., Plain City, Ohio. In this role he will assist with the preparation of advertisements and brochures, help photograph bulls and bull progeny, and work on other beef-marketing projects. He will be based at the Select federation's headquarters office in Plain City.

Wells is a senior at The Ohio State University, Columbus, Ohio, where he is planning to graduate this fall with a bachelor's degree in animal science and a minor in agricultural business. He is an active member of Alpha Gamma Sigma and has served as president. Wells is also a member of Saddle and Sirloin, and the 2004 livestock judging team. Wells grew up on a 50-acre, 50-cow purebred Angus farm and is the son of Ray and Kathy Wells.
